A property in Windsor has been slammed with two closure orders following a drugs raid by police.

On Tuesday, November 7 the neighborhood problem-solving team and the tasking team were successful in executing two drug warrants at Hanover Way, Windsor.

After a number of suspected class A drugs, drug paraphernalia, and a knife were seized the closure orders were granted by the courts for a period of three months.

Due to these discoveries, several people are now being investigated for being concerned in being concerned with the supply of class A drugs and one arrest has been made.

Police have explained on their social media where they reported the closure that no one other than the occupants, police and partnership agencies will be allowed access to this house,

A spokesman for Thames Valley Police said: “If you suspect that similar illegal drug activity is occurring in your neighbourhood then you can report these concerns to 101 or, in an emergency, call 999.”
